Stefanie Kaesche is a scholar working on Condensed Matter Physics, Geophysics and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Stefanie Kaesche has authored 13 papers receiving a total of 444 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Condensed Matter Physics, 5 papers in Geophysics and 5 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Stefanie Kaesche’s work include Physics of Superconductivity and Magnetism (10 papers), Advanced Condensed Matter Physics (4 papers) and Phase Change Materials Research (3 papers). Stefanie Kaesche is often cited by papers focused on Physics of Superconductivity and Magnetism (10 papers), Advanced Condensed Matter Physics (4 papers) and Phase Change Materials Research (3 papers). Stefanie Kaesche collaborates with scholars based in Germany, United States and Belgium. Stefanie Kaesche's co-authors include Thomas Bauer, Peter Majewski, Fritz Aldinger, Markus Eck, Nicole Pfleger, Doerte Laing, Nils Breidenbach, Markus Braun, Alexander Bonk and A. Sotelo and has published in prestigious journals such as Advanced Materials, Applied Energy and Journal of the American Ceramic Society.
